RESUMO

We report the emergence of cefiderocol resistance in a blaOXA-72 carbapenem-resistant Acinetobacter baumannii isolate from a sacral decubitus ulcer. Cefiderocol was initially used; however, a newly approved sulbactam-durlobactam therapy with source control and flap coverage was successful in treating the infection. Laboratory investigation revealed cefiderocol resistance mediated by ISAba36 insertion into the siderophore receptor pirA.

RESUMO

BACKGROUND: Although most cases of Hansen disease (HD) in the United States are imported from endemic areas, a subset of cases are relate to exposure to nine-banded armadillos. Several recent cases of HD in Arkansas occurred in patients who had not traveled to endemic areas and who reported variable degrees of armadillo exposure. OBJECTIVE: The purpose of this study was to report 6 cases of HD diagnosed in Arkansas between 2004 and 2016. The secondary purpose was to explore the correlation between exposure to the nine-banded armadillo as it pertains to transmission of the disease. METHODS: The referring clinician of each patient was contacted to gather information regarding the patient's clinical presentation, armadillo exposure, and travel history. In addition, the Arkansas Department of Health was consulted to review the demographics of individuals diagnosed with HD in the past 15 years and to review the distribution of HD throughout the state of Arkansas. RESULTS: Six domestic cases of HD were associated with both direct and indirect exposure to armadillos. LIMITATIONS: Armadillo exposure may be underreported in patients with HD because of fear of stigmatization and/or lack of access to care. CONCLUSIONS: Direct exposure to armadillos does not appear to be required for transmission of HD making a soil-mediated mechanism of indirect exposure plausible.

RESUMO

BACKGROUND: Platelet refractoriness or lack of platelet increase after platelet transfusion is seen in patients receiving chronic platelet transfusion support. Antibodies may develop against human platelet antigens (HPA) and/or against HLA class I antigens. Crossmatch (XM) compatible platelets or HLA-identical or HLA-compatible platelets are typically used to manage transfusion refractoriness. We aimed to determine if percent calculated Panel Reactive Antibody (% cPRA) against class I HLA antigens could predict percent positive platelet XM when looking for compatible transfusion products. METHODS: A retrospective review of all platelet XM performed at our institution between 2008-2012 was performed, and patient characteristics recorded. For each patient, the percentage of all positive platelet XM performed was calculated and compared with the corresponding % cPRA levels against class I HLA antigens. RESULTS: Mean and median % positive platelet XM for all 50 patients tested in the period 2008-2012 were 61% and 60% (range 0-100%), respectively. Mean and median % cPRA levels were 66% and 68% (range 0-100%), respectively. No correlation was seen between age, sex, race, or diagnosis and positive platelet XM results. CONCLUSION: The results of our study indicate that the % cPRA correlates well with the % positive platelet XM. Thus, a higher % cPRA alerts the blood bank that additional platelets will be required for XM and/or that it would be beneficial to request HLA-identical or compatible units.

RESUMO

BACKGROUND: Panel reactive antibody (PRA) reduction protocols are used to decrease anti-HLA antibodies with concomitant PRA monitoring as a measure of successful treatment prior to organ and haploidentical blood and marrow transplant (BMT). We hypothesized that the more sensitive flow cytometry (FC) based assays for PRA [FlowPRA® and Luminex® based Single Antigen Bead (SAB)] would also correlate with the ability to find compatible platelets for allosensitized recipients. METHODS: A female patient with myelodysplastic syndrome and a high HLA class I PRA [>90% PRA and cPRA by complement-dependent cytotoxicity (CDC) assay and Flow PRA] required allogeneic BMT. Baseline HLA Class I and class II antigen typing was performed and a matched sibling donor was identified. Although baseline anti-HLA class I and class II antibodies measured by FC and CDC revealed no donor specific antibodies (DSA), the decision was made to attempt antibody desensitization to facilitate platelet transfusion during BMT. FC and CDC assays were performed to determine anti-HLA class I antibodies and cPRA/%PRA prior to starting desensitization and at the end of desensitization. Over the course of desensitization and BMT, a total of 194 apheresis platelet units underwent cross-match (XM) using Capture-P®. We compared temporally-related PRA results with platelet XM results. RESULTS: High PRA by FC or CDC assays correlates with a high % of XM-positive (incompatible) platelet units. When the CDC PRA fell to 2% after desensitization, platelet XM incompatibility fell from 100% to 63% positive (incompatible). When the FC PRA fell to 5% the positive platelet XM fell to 5%. CONCLUSIONS: Antibody desensitization facilitated platelet transfusion. PRA determination by FC appeared better correlated than determination by CDC with the ability to find XM-compatible platelets.

RESUMO

A 65-year-old female with a history of multiple tick bites presented with fever and pancytopenia. Intracytoplasmic rickettsial morulae were detected on peripheral smear and bone marrow biopsy specimens, and PCR amplified Ehrlichia ewingii DNA from both specimens. To our knowledge, this is the first report of E. ewingii infection of human bone marrow.

RESUMO

Mobilization regimens for CD34+ cells have generally been judged successful based on the number of cells collected without evaluating mobilization separately from collection. Using retrospective data for patients who collected CD34+ cells on Total Therapy protocols 3a/3b (VTD-PACE) and Total Therapy 4/5 using a novel regimen that added low dose melphalan to VTD-PACE (MVTD-PACE), we analyzed mobilization and collection variables separately. A significant difference favoring MVDT-PACE was found in mean CD34+ cells/µL on day 2 of collection and in mean ratio of CD34+ cells/µL on day 2 to day 1. However, because apheresis variables and growth factor dose during collection were manipulated to optimize individual collections, the two regimens were not significantly different when the mean total CD34+ cells ×10(6) /kg collected was compared. Thus, when evaluating a chemotherapy regimen or new growth factor for mobilization, it is important to realize that total CD34+ cells collected is dependent on both mobilization and collection variables.

RESUMO

BACKGROUND AIMS: The ability to predict how many CD34(+) cells a donor will collect on a given day is vital for efficient leukapheresis. METHODS: We validated a formula to predict daily CD34(+) cell collections by leukapheresis, calculated as follows: (peripheral blood CD34(+) cells/L) × (adjusted collection efficiency of 30%)/body weight (kg), multiplied by the number of liters processed. This validation was performed from 234 donors undergoing 30 L large volume leukapheresis (LVL) and 162 donors undergoing smaller collections (non-LVL). The LVL group consisted of 811 collection events (625 multiple myeloma, 186 non-myeloma). The non-LVL group consisted of 224 collection events (196 multiple myeloma, 28 non-myeloma). All predicted and observed CD34(+) cell collection numbers were plotted (predicted versus observed) and assessed using linear regression analyses. Linear correlation coefficients (r-values), slopes and intercepts of the regression lines were evaluated. RESULTS: Predicted versus observed data points across all quantities of CD34(+) cells/kg collected by both LVL and non-LVL had strong r-values of 0.947 and 0.913, respectively, demonstrating near perfect positive linear correlations. Data for LVL collections subgrouped by number of cells collected (poor, intermediate and good), mobilization regimen, collection day and diagnosis were analyzed the same way and showed consistent findings. CONCLUSIONS: We have validated a formula with a strong ability to predict collection of CD34(+) cells/kg that would allow for individualization of collection for any donor once the peripheral blood CD34(+) cell count and optimal goal of collection were known; to date this has not been published by other groups.
